WebNov 3, 2024 · 3. Factory reset via the Installation disk. Insert the installation disk into your PC, press the power button, and select boot from the Windows 10 installation disk. Click the Repair your computer option on the Install now screen. Click the Troubleshoot option, then select Reset this PC from the Troubleshooting menu. WebFeb 26, 2024 · Reboot your computer and press Alt + F10 as soon as the Gateway or Acer logo appears. You may need to press the keys a couple times in order for them to register.
